    What are the various applications of compressed air within industrial settings?

    In industrial settings, compressed air serves as a medium for energy transmission within facility operations. This form of energy can be harnessed to empower tools like air hammers, drills, and spanners. Additionally, it finds applications in tasks such as atomizing paint, actuating air cylinders, and even facilitating the propulsion of vehicles. 25th February, 2021

    What significance does the pneumatic system hold within the contemporary industrial landscape?

    Air-powered transmission methodologies frequently emerge as the optimal solution for relocating components and implements within industrial machinery. These pneumatic frameworks undertake a vast array of duties within automated setups, encompassing operations like clamping, gripping, precise positioning, elevating, pressing, relocating, segregating, and arranging items in stacks. 28th January, 2016

    Which real-world machines or devices incorporate the utilization of pneumatics in their functioning?

    A wide array of construction machinery incorporates pneumatic systems as their primary driving force. Illustratively, tools such as jackhammers and nail guns harness the energy of compressed air to function effectively. Furthermore, in the realm of aviation, aircraft frequently rely on pneumatic systems for diverse purposes, encompassing pressure regulation, actuation mechanisms, and even cooling systems.
